Northeast Guilford has been a dominant force so far, but they're in the middle of a mini-slump at the moment. They took a 66-56 hit to the loss column at the hands of the Dudley Panthers on Tuesday. The Rams were not able to make up for their loss to the Panthers from their previous meeting back in February of 2024.
Northeast Guilford's defeat dropped their record down to 8-3. As for Dudley, the victory was the third in a row for them, bringing their record for this year to 6-5.
Both squads are looking forward to the support of their home crowds in their upcoming games. Northeast Guilford will welcome Atkins at 8:00 p.m. on Friday. As for Dudley, a feisty cat fight will be fought when the Dudley Panthers duke it out with the Rockingham County Cougars at 8:00 p.m. on Friday.
